Ferries run from Makarska to Bol, Brač 2 times a week from June to September. The first ferry of the day departs from Makarska at 18:50, and the last at 18:50. The fastest ferry can reach Bol, Brač in just 30min, while on average the journey takes around 30min. One-way tickets start at just €20.00 and can cost up to €20.00. How to get from Makarska to Bol, Brač
To get from Makarska to Bol on the island of Brač, the ferry is the best option. Ferries generally depart from the Makarska port, which is conveniently located near the city center and easily accessible from local hotels and the bus station. You can catch a bus or taxi to the port, with services running frequently throughout the day. The journey to the port typically takes around 10 to 15 minutes, making it a simple transfer before your ferry ride.
At the port, you will find a designated area for ferry departures, usually marked clearly with signage. It’s common for travelers to gather near the terminal, where ticket counters and displays provide real-time updates on schedules. Remember to arrive a little earlier than your departure time to ensure everything is ready and to check for any last-minute changes.

Finding your way to Makarska ferry port
The Makarska ferry port is located near the city center, just a short walk from popular landmarks like the Makarska Riva promenade. It is easily accessible by car, taxi, or public transport. If you're coming from Split, take the D8 highway, which takes about 1.5 hours. Local buses also run regularly from major cities to Makarska.
The ferry terminal in Bol, Brač, is located near the town center, making it convenient for visitors. It's about a 15-minute walk from the beaches and local restaurants.

Exploring Bol, Brač
Bol, located on the island of Brač in Croatia, is a beautiful place that has something for everyone. One of its most famous spots is Zlatni Rat Beach. This beach has a unique shape that changes with the waves and is perfect for swimming and sunbathing. The water is bright blue, and the sand feels warm under your feet!
While you're in Bol, you can visit the old Dominican Monastery with its lovely garden. For nature lovers, there are amazing paths to explore in the nearby hills. You can hike or bike and enjoy stunning views of the sea and nearby islands. Don't forget to try some local food, like fresh fish or delicious grilled meat, served in cozy restaurants.
Bol is great for short visits, but it is also a perfect starting point to explore other nearby places, like the charming town of Supetar or even nearby islands like Hvar. You can have fun discovering new spots every day! With its stunning beaches and fun activities, Bol is a wonderful destination for families and friends.
